Applications
Pelargonidin 3,5-diglucoside (CAS 17334-58-6) is a natural anthocyanin pigment primarily used as a natural colorant in foods and beverages, imparting red to pink hues that vary with pH; it is also employed as a colorant in cosmetics and personal care formulations. Additionally, this compound has been evaluated as a natural dye for inks and coatings. It is studied for potential antioxidant activity in nutraceutical formulations or colorant applications in dietary supplement products. Its pH sensitivity makes it suitable as a colorimetric indicator in analytical contexts or pH-responsive packaging. All uses are subject to local regulations and formulation limits.
